Planning a cultural immersion experience can significantly enhance your travel experience, allowing you to deeply connect with the local culture rather than just skim its surface. This guide will provide you with a step-by-step approach to planning such experiences effectively.

Step 1: Define Your Cultural Interests

Before hitting the road, it's crucial to identify what aspects of the local culture intrigue you. Are you drawn to traditional music, art, cooking, or perhaps local festivals? Defining your interests will help narrow your choices and give your trip direction. For instance, if culinary arts fascinate you, researching cooking classes or food tours should be a priority. Websites like TripAdvisor and Viator offer extensive listings of local experiences that cater to various interests.

Additionally, reaching out to travelers who have previously visited your destination can provide insights. Social media platforms and travel forums can be incredibly resourceful. This preparatory step helps you avoid common pitfalls, such as over-scheduling activities that leave little room for spontaneous cultural encounters. Focus on quality rather than quantity, ensuring you’re not just ticking off items on a checklist.

Step 2: Engage with Locals

An essential part of true cultural immersion is engaging with local residents. One way to do this is by staying in locally-owned accommodations rather than international hotel chains. Consider options like Airbnb or hostels that host local experiences. This not only supports the local economy but also gives you a more authentic perspective of daily life.

Engagement can take many forms; participating in community events, attending workshops, or even simply striking up conversations with locals can unveil layers of the community that guidebooks often overlook. According to a survey by Booking.com, 42% of travelers reported that meeting locals enhanced their travel experience. Therefore, embracing opportunities for interaction pays off by enriching your stay.

Step 3: Research Cultural Etiquette

Understanding local customs and etiquette is another fundamental aspect of planning a successful cultural immersion experience. Cultures around the world have unique etiquette that, if overlooked, can lead to misunderstandings or even offense. For example, in some Asian countries, it is considered disrespectful to point with your feet, while in the Middle East, consuming food with your left hand is frowned upon.

A comprehensive primer on the culture and etiquette of your destination can help avoid awkward situations. Utilize resources like Etiquette International or even travel blogs to gather information regarding appropriate behaviors. Familiarizing yourself will signal respect to the locals and provide a more profound connection during your travels.

Step 4: Plan Your Activities with Intention

When scheduling your itinerary, prioritize activities that enhance cultural understanding over conventional tourist attractions. Instead of visiting only famous landmarks, seek out local workshops, community festivals, or spiritual ceremonies. For instance, participating in a traditional dance class can provide firsthand insights into the region’s culture and history.

Additionally, according to a study by National Geographic, travelers who partake in cultural experiences report deeper satisfaction levels than those who just sightsee. Volunteering can also be an excellent way to engage; many organizations welcome travelers who wish to lend a helping hand, paving the way for connection and experience.

Step 5: Embrace Spontaneity

While planning is necessary, allowing spontaneity into your travels can lead to exceptional experiences. Once you arrive at your destination, be open to unplanned events and interactions. Consider floating around a local market or festival; the spontaneous conversations and experiences you find could shape your trip significantly.

Moreover, language exchange meetups, often hosted in cafes or community centers, can also offer serendipitous educational experiences. According to travel experts, some of the most memorable travel moments stem from unplanned occurrences. Keep your itinerary flexible enough to embrace these rich opportunities.
